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/ vue / mysql / linux / python / javascript / html / css / c++ / c#

js 获取滚动条位置

作者:冷轩长风   发布日期:2025-09-29   浏览:36

// 获取滚动条位置的示例代码

// 获取页面垂直方向上的滚动距离
let scrollTop = window.pageYOffset || document.documentElement.scrollTop || document.body.scrollTop;

// 获取页面水平方向上的滚动距离
let scrollLeft = window.pageXOffset || document.documentElement.scrollLeft || document.body.scrollLeft;

console.log("Vertical Scroll Position: " + scrollTop);
console.log("Horizontal Scroll Position: " + scrollLeft);

解释说明:

  • window.pageYOffsetwindow.pageXOffset 是标准的属性,用于获取页面在垂直和水平方向上的滚动距离。
  • document.documentElement.scrollTopdocument.documentElement.scrollLeft 用于兼容某些旧版浏览器(如IE)。
  • document.body.scrollTopdocument.body.scrollLeft 也是为了兼容更老的浏览器版本。

通过这种方式,可以确保在不同浏览器中都能正确获取滚动条的位置。

上一篇:js form

下一篇:js scrolltop

大家都在看

js 数组对象排序

js 数组删掉第一个值

js fill

js 数组连接

js json数组

js 数组复制

js 复制数组

js 数组拷贝

js 对象数组合并

js 对象转数组

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站